Preparing a Home for Sale

Share This Post

Preparing a home for sale is a crucial step in attracting potential buyers and getting the best possible price.

Here are some key steps to consider:

1. **Clean and Declutter**: Start by thoroughly cleaning the entire house, including windows, floors, and carpets. Declutter by removing personal items and excess furniture. A clean and clutter-free space looks more appealing.

2. **Repairs and Maintenance**: Fix any visible issues like leaky faucets, peeling paint, or broken fixtures. Address minor repairs to make the house move-in ready.

3. **Curb Appeal**: First impressions matter. Improve your home’s exterior by maintaining the lawn, trimming bushes, and adding fresh mulch. Consider painting the front door and adding potted plants for a welcoming entrance.

4. **Neutralize and Depersonalize**: Paint walls in neutral colors to appeal to a broader range of buyers. Remove personal items like family photos to help potential buyers envision themselves in the space.

5. **Staging**: Consider professional staging to showcase your home’s potential. Staging can help buyers see how spaces can be used and make the property more inviting.

6. **Lighting**: Ensure all rooms are well-lit. Replace old or dim light fixtures and open curtains to let in natural light. Bright spaces feel more inviting.

7. **Kitchen and Bathrooms**: These areas can significantly impact a sale. Ensure they are clean and in good repair. Consider minor upgrades like replacing hardware or adding fresh grout.

8. **Odor Control**: Eliminate any odors, especially pet or cooking smells. Use air fresheners or diffusers with pleasant scents.

9. **Cabinet and Closet Space**: Organize cabinets and closets to showcase available storage space. Buyers often look for ample storage.

10. **Small Details**: Pay attention to small details like doorknobs, cabinet handles, and switch plates. These minor improvements can make a big difference.

11. **Photography**: Hire a professional photographer to take high-quality photos for online listings. Good photos can attract more interest.

12. **Marketing**: Work with a realtor to market your property effectively. Online listings, social media, and traditional advertising methods can all help.

13. **Pricing**: Price your home competitively based on the local market and recent comparable sales. An overpriced home can deter potential buyers.

14. **Flexible Showings**: Be flexible with showing times to accommodate potential buyers’ schedules.

15. **Disclosures**: Ensure you provide all necessary disclosures about the property’s condition, repairs, or any known issues.

Remember that each home sale is unique, and the steps you need to take may vary depending on your specific circumstances and the local real estate market conditions. Consulting with a real estate agent can be invaluable in guiding you through the process and helping you make the best decisions to maximize your home’s sale potential.
